I had blonde hair and died it red for about a year. I would recommend going to a salon and having them do a color removal process then dying it back to blonde. If you want to do it at home, Sally's Beauty Supply has a product called "No Red" and you can mix it with your shampoo or get purple shampoo which might help, but it will be quite a process.
